Piston engines have long been a cornerstone of public transportation, particularly in bus and coach fleets. Despite the increasing interest in alternative propulsion systems such as electric and hydrogen fuel cells, piston engines remain a reliable and versatile option for many operators. This article explores the benefits of piston engines in bus and coach fleets, highlighting their efficiency, performance, and overall practicality.

One of the primary advantages of piston engines is their established efficiency. Diesel and gasoline engines have undergone decades of refinement, resulting in improved fuel economy and reduced emissions. Modern piston engines are designed to maximize fuel utilization, enabling buses and coaches to travel longer distances on less fuel. This efficiency is particularly beneficial in urban environments, where fuel costs can quickly accumulate due to stop-and-go traffic.

Another significant benefit is performance. Piston engines provide excellent torque and power characteristics, essential for heavy vehicles like buses and coaches. This power enables these vehicles to accelerate quickly, tackle steep grades, and carry significant passenger loads without sacrificing performance. Furthermore, the reliability of modern piston engines, combined with advanced transmission systems, ensures smooth operation even in challenging driving conditions.
Maintenance and repair are also simplified with piston engines. Their commonality means that parts are readily available and often more affordable compared to other propulsion systems. Additionally, many technicians are more familiar with piston engine technology, facilitating faster and more cost-effective servicing for fleet operators. This ease of maintenance translates into reduced downtime and lower operational costs, which are critical factors for bus and coach companies striving to maintain profitability.
Moreover, the infrastructure for fueling piston-engine vehicles is well-established. Diesel pumps are available at numerous fueling stations, making it convenient for bus and coach drivers to refuel quickly. This accessibility allows fleets to maintain their schedules without significant disruptions caused by fuel shortages, a critical element for public transport systems requiring high reliability.
